Output e027262df63bb997040463890415063f281cf53e23630d919b0337ccc4247003:1

value
410342065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ba695f1c0d90e1b0fbcc0f1f4623b815848a51f2 OP_EQUAL
address
3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E
transaction
e027262df63bb997040463890415063f281cf53e23630d919b0337ccc4247003
spent
true